What Are Indices Trading Hours?

Indices trading hours refer to the specific timeframes during which global stock indices are open for trading. These hours vary depending on the region and the exchange where the index is traded. Knowing the indices market hours is essential for planning your trades and maximizing opportunities.

Understanding Quotation Hours

Quotation hours refer to the time during which price quotes (bid and ask prices) are available for a specific index. These hours may differ slightly from trading hours, as they include pre-market and post-market sessions where quotes are still provided, but trading activity may be limited.

Why Quotation Hours Matter:

Price Discovery

Quotation hours help traders gauge market sentiment and potential price movements before the market officially opens or closes.

Strategic Planning

By monitoring quotes during these hours, traders can plan their entry and exit points more effectively.

Extended Opportunities

Quotation hours allow traders to react to news or events that occur outside regular trading hours.

The Importance of Knowing Indices Market Hours

Understanding indices trading hours is critical for:

Timing Your Trades

Align your trades with peak market activity for better liquidity and tighter spreads.

Global Opportunities

Trade indices from different regions, such as Asia, Europe, and the US, by knowing their specific hours.

Risk Management

Avoid trading during low-volume periods to minimize risks.
